Robotic Summer School 2010

Students from all over Europe attend robot summer school in Bratislava

As well as lectures, the programme also include excursions and workshops, giving students hands-on experience and enabling them to bring their own robots to life.

Lectures

  • History and cultural context of R.U.R. (Jozef Kelemen, Silezian University, Opava, CZ)
  • Introduction to the Digital Signal Processing (Gerhard Gruhler, University Heilbronn, DE)
  • Mobile Robot Kinematics (Peter Hubinský, Slovak University of Technology in Bratislava, SK)
  • Roboat - World’s Leading Robotic Sailboat (Roland Stelzer, InnoC.at)
  • Artificial Intelligence for Robotics (Pavel Petrovič, Comenius University, Bratislava, SK)
  • Roboat - Layered Architecture (Karim Jafarmadar, InnoC.at)
  • History of Robotics (Peter Hubinský, Slovak University of Technology in Bratislava, SK)
  • Visual Systems Workshop (Andrej Lúčny, Comenius University, Bratislava, SK)
  • Fuzzy Neural Navigation (Anton Vitko, Slovak University of Technology in Bratislava, SK)

The Robotic Summer School is part of Centrobot, a cross-border robotics initiative, and was run by the Centrobot Consortium in collaboration with BEST Vienna.
